All episodes

Nikki and de Mello

Nikki & de Mello's Party Bag - Ep 1091

11 minutes | Wednesday, 22 November 2023

Another scorcher for Perth and the Peel, Top Gear finally wraps up on the BBC, some highly questionable menu items on a Chinese business class menu and three more years for Dambo's Giants...

Pic -

Nikki & de Mello's Party Bag - Ep 1091
Nikki and de Mello

Use the arrow keys to increase and decrease the volume, or space to toggle mute.